摘要
Background: Multiple sclerosis is a demyelinating chronic neurologic disease that can lead to disability and thus to deterioration of quality of life. Psychological parameters such as ego defense mechanisms, defense styles and family environment are important factors in the adaptation process, and as such they can play important roles in QoL. This study aims to assess the psychological factors as well as the clinical and demographic characteristics related to mental health quality of life (MHQoL). Methods: This was an observational, cross-sectional study conducted in a sample of 90 people with MS in the years 2018-2020. All participants completed the following questionnaires: MSQoL-54, DSQ-88, LSI, FES-R, SOC, BDI-II, STAI. Disability was assessed using EDSS. Results: In multiple linear regression, significant roles were played by depression (R-2: 41.1%, p: 0.001) and, to a lesser extent, the event of a relapse (R-2: 3.5%, p: 0.005), expressiveness (R-2: 3.6%, p < 0.05) and image distortion style (R-2: 4.5%, p: 0.032). After performing a hierarchical-stepwise analysis (excluding depression), the important factors were maladaptive defense style (R-2: 23.7%, p: 0.002), the event of relapse (R-2: 8.1%, p < 0.001), expressiveness (R-2: 5.5%, p: 0.004) and self-sacrificing defense style (R-2: 2.4%, p: 0.071). Conclusion: Psychological factors play important roles in MHQoL of people with multiple sclerosis. Thus, neurologists should integrate in their practice an assessment by mental health specialists.Moreover, targeted psychotherapeutic interventions could be planned i to improve QoL.
